M400-SDI SENTRY – Fast Ship

The SIG Sauer M400‑SDI Sentry is a fully‑configured 5.56 NATO rifle that includes a SIG ROMEO5 GENII red‑dot sight, FOXTROT‑MSR™ full‑size weapon light, and vertical foregrip—everything you need for home defense, training, or tactical use right out of the box.

In a market flooded with budget AR‑15s, the SIG Sauer M400‑SDI Sentry stands out with a complete ready‑to‑go package. Here’s why.

Full Spec Sheet

Caliber 5.56 NATO / .223 Remington
Barrel Length 16 inches
Overall Length 32.5 inches (stock extended)
Weight (unloaded) 7.2 lbs
Magazine Capacity 30 rounds (one PMAG included)
Rail System M‑LOK handguard, 15 inches
Upper Receiver Forged 7075‑T6 aluminum with forward assist and dust cover
Lower Receiver Forged 7075‑T6 aluminum with ambidextrous safety selector
Trigger Single‑stage mil‑spec, approximately 6.5 lbs pull
Stock 6‑position SIG Minimalist stock
Grip SIG Sauer pistol grip with storage compartment
Optic SIG ROMEO5 GENII 1x red dot (2 MOA dot)
Weapon Light SIG FOXTROT‑MSR™ full‑size (500 lumens, strobe capable)
Foregrip SIG vertical foregrip (M‑LOK attachable)

Range Performance

We took the M400‑SDI Sentry to the range with 500 rounds of mixed 5.56 ammunition—PMC X‑TAC 55‑grain, Federal American Eagle 62‑grain, and Hornady Frontier 75‑grain BTHP. Zeroing the ROMEO5 took about 10 rounds at 50 yards; the turrets clicked positively, and the dot stayed true through the session.

Accuracy was excellent for a rifle in this class. With the 75‑grain Hornady match ammo, we achieved 1.5‑inch groups at 100 yards from a bench. With bulk ammo, groups opened to about 2.5 inches—still plenty for defensive work. The rifle cycled everything without a single malfunction, including steel‑cased .223.

Shooting from standing, the vertical foregrip helped control muzzle rise during rapid strings. The weapon light’s momentary switch is easy to reach with your support‑hand thumb, and the strobe function disorients in low‑light drills. The ROMEO5’s 2‑MOA dot is crisp, and the auto‑brightness sensor adjusts well to changing light.

Build Quality & Ergonomics

The M400‑SDI Sentry feels solid. The receivers are forged aluminum with a matte black anodized finish that resists scratching. The M‑LOK handguard has a slight texture for grip, and the barrel is nitride‑treated for corrosion resistance. SIG’s attention to detail shows in the staked gas key, properly torqued barrel nut, and dimpled takedown pins.

Ergonomics are excellent. The ambidextrous safety selector is a welcome addition—left‑handed shooters can operate it with their trigger finger. The magazine release is also reversible. The SIG Minimalist stock locks firmly in each position and doesn’t wobble. The pistol grip has a storage compartment for batteries or small tools.

Who Needs This?

First‑time AR‑15 buyers

The Sentry eliminates the guesswork. You get a fully‑functional rifle with proven accessories, no need to research optics or lights. Everything is already mounted, zeroed, and tested—just add ammunition and head to the range.

Home‑defense users

With the red dot zeroed and the light mounted, this rifle is ready for low‑light scenarios. The 5.56 round minimizes over‑penetration compared to pistol calibers, and the rifle’s reliability means it’ll work when you need it most.

Training instructors

A reliable, accurate rifle that students can learn on. The included accessories teach proper use of optics and weapon‑mounted lights. The ambidextrous controls accommodate both right‑ and left‑handed shooters.

Tactical enthusiasts

The M400‑SDI platform is used by law‑enforcement and military units worldwide. This package gives you that capability without custom gunsmithing. The rifle is ready for carbine courses, competition, or duty use.

Quick Answers

Does the M400‑SDI Sentry come with iron sights?

No, the rifle ships with the SIG ROMEO5 red dot only. You can add backup iron sights if desired.

Can I remove the vertical foregrip?

Yes, the foregrip attaches via M‑LOK and can be removed in seconds.

Is the barrel threaded for a suppressor?

Yes, the barrel has a ½x28 thread pattern under the flash hider.

What battery does the ROMEO5 use?

One CR2032 battery (included). Battery life is approximately 50,000 hours.

Does SIG ship directly to my FFL?

Yes, SIG ships to any licensed FFL in the continental US. You’ll need to complete the transfer paperwork locally.

Is the FOXTROT‑MSR light rechargeable?

No, it uses two CR123A batteries (included). Runtime is about 1.5 hours on high.

Can I replace the handguard?

Yes, the handguard is attached via a standard barrel nut. Any M‑LOK or KeyMod handguard with the same length should fit.

What’s the trigger like?

It’s a standard mil‑spec single‑stage trigger with a 6.5‑lb pull. It’s serviceable, but many shooters upgrade to a Geissele or LaRue trigger for precision work.
